How RTP and Volatility Influence Your Session

Every slot title launched in the UK market carries a listed return-to-player percentage, often abbreviated as RTP, which reflects the long-term payback. At Zombillion Casino, players can find this figure within the game’s help file, usually expressed as a number such as 96.2% or 94.5%. RTP alone does not determine whether a single session will end in profit; it is a reference, not a certainty. Volatility, or variance, functions as the second important lever that shapes the experience. Low-volatility slots provide frequent but minor wins that help preserve a bankroll across hundreds of spins, rendering them appropriate for players who prefer extended sessions and bonus wagering requirements. High-volatility games, by contrast, produce fewer payouts but have the possibility for big win sequences, which can either swiftly deplete a balance or trigger a big multiplier. A smart approach tries both profiles using Zombillion Casino’s demo-play feature, because feeling the dry spells and sudden bursts without risk teaches more than any abstract explanation. Pairing RTP knowledge with volatility awareness transforms slot selection from guesswork into a careful tactical decision.

Table Game Options and Their Gameplay Depth

Zombillion Casino’s table game collection offers players who invest time learning optimal strategy, because small rule variations alter the house edge more dramatically than most casual visitors realise. A standard European roulette wheel with a single zero gives the casino a 2.70% advantage, while American roulette with its additional double-zero pocket nearly multiplies that figure to 5.26%. Blackjack enthusiasts should seek tables where the dealer stands on soft 17 and where a natural blackjack pays the full 3:2, avoiding the diminished 6:5 payout that quietly diminishes returns over time. The lobby’s filter tools enable UK players to find low-stakes tables if they are practising basic strategy charts, or higher-limit variants when they are prepared to exploit favourable rules. Baccarat remains a beautifully simple proposition, with the banker wager carrying a house edge of just 1.06% after commission, making it one of the most mathematically friendly bets on the entire site. Every table game at Zombillion Casino shows its specific rules before the first hand is dealt, so a smart player always stops to read them.

Promotional Frameworks and How They Affect Game Choice

Zombillion Casino greets UK players through a promotional package that commonly includes a deposit match and a batch of free spins, but the real story emerges in the terms and conditions tied to every offer. Wagering requirements determine how many times the bonus funds must be played through before any winnings become withdrawable cash, and not all games count equally toward that target. Video slots almost always clear 100% of the requirement, while table games such as blackjack or roulette may contribute only 5% or 10%, a detail that radically alters the viability of using a blackjack strategy to churn through a bonus. A smart player checks the bonus terms with the game weighting table before choosing which title to load, because spending hours on a high-RTP, low-volatility slot that clears the wagering faster is often more efficient than chasing big wins on a volatile game that could erase the bonus balance early. Other critical conditions include maximum bet limits during bonus play, typically capped around five pounds per spin or hand, and expiration windows that range from seven to thirty days. Exceeding the max bet can void the bonus and any associated winnings, so Zombillion Casino’s interface warns players when they approach the threshold.

Practical Tips for Enduring Pleasure and Bankroll Management

Smart game choice directly supports effective bankroll management, because the two disciplines cannot be split without one weakening the other. A perfectly chosen blackjack variant with a 0.5% house edge still exhausts funds if the player over‑bets relative to their total balance, while a low-volatility slot can protect capital only if the session length aligns with the unit stake size. At Zombillion Casino, the responsible gambling suite enables players to set deposit limits that refresh on a daily, weekly or monthly cycle, and tying these to the volatility of chosen games creates a self‑enforcing structure. A player who favours high-variance slots should set a lower daily cap than one who sticks to even-money roulette bets or low-volatility fruit machines, because the natural drawdowns are more significant and faster. Reality-check timers pop up at customisable intervals, gently reminding the player to check that the session still aligns with their original selection logic. This blend of technical game knowledge and behavioural guardrails guarantees that smart selection results in genuine long‑term enjoyment rather than reactive chasing.

  • Split the session bankroll into units: Allocate 100–200 units per session for low-volatility games, or 300‑plus units for high-volatility slots to absorb swings.
  • Align bet size to the return cycle: On a 96% RTP slot, a 1‑pound spin across 1,000 spins involves an expected theoretical cost of 40 pounds; scale wagers so that the expected expense is comfortable comfortably.
  • Use win and loss limits tactically: Stop the session after doubling the starting balance or losing half of it, and let the next day’s freshly selected game offer a clean psychological slate.
  • Log game performance: Keep a simple note of which titles gave stable sessions and which led to impulsive bet raises, forming a personal blacklist and whitelist over time.
  • Switch categories intentionally: Move from slots to a live dealer table after a big win to preserve the rush while reducing the pace of expenditure.
